С какими субд работает система 1с предприятие 8

Обновлено: 06.07.2024

В настоящее время компания 1С почти полностью реализовала концепцию многоплатформенности . Полноценная клиентская часть теперь может запускаться не только из-под Windows , но и из-под Linux . Более того, в скором времени 1С обещает порадовать обладателей Mac - Book выпуском клиента под Mac OS (на данный момент выпущена ознакомительная бета-версия) . В Таблице 1 указаны компоненты технологической платформы 1С :П редприятие 8.3 и совместимые с ними операционные системы. Далее краткая расшифровка этих компонент:

· Разница между тонким и толстым клиентом не только в размере дистрибутива и уровне нагрузки на клиентские компьютеры. Тонкий клиент может работать только с конфигурациями, имеющими интерфейс на «управляемых формах», например, 1С :Б ухгалтерия предприятия 3.0», «1С: ERP 2.0», «1С :Управление торговлей 11», «1С:Зарплата и управление персоналом 3.0». «Обычные формы» имеют, например, конфигурации: «1С :Б ухгалтерия предприятия 2.0», «1С:Управление производственным предприятием», «1С:Управление торговлей 10.3», «1С:Зарплата и управление персоналом 2.5». Толстый клиент обеспечивает полную функциональность – и «управляемые формы» и «обычные формы» и режим «Конфигуратор» для разработчиков.

· Под Веб-клиентом подразумевается любой современный браузер (например, Microsoft Internet Explorer , Mozilla Firefox , Google Chrome , Safari …) практически в любой операционной среде. Он так же как и тонкий клиент работает только с конфигурациями на «управляемых формах». Браузеры под Android в принципе тоже работают, но с ограничением – не работает прокрутка пальцем в форме списка. В iPhone такого недостатка нет.

· Сервер 1С :П редприятие является важной частью концепции «трехзвенная архитектура», и играет роль сервера приложений. Такая схема работы еще называется «клиент-серверная», в ней в отличие от «файл-серверной» достигается эффект масштабируемости – существенно уменьшается зависимость производительности от количества пользователей и объема базы данных. По сути это посредник между сервером баз данных и клиентскими компьютерами. Сервер 1С обеспечивает взаимодействие с сервером баз данных, в частности механизм «управляемых блокировок», повышающий параллельность работы пользователей. Так же он берет на себя многие «тяжелые» вычислительные задачи, существенно разгружая клиентские компьютеры. В файл-серверной архитектуре клиентские компьютеры подключены непосредственно к файлу с базой данных, при этом показатели производительности и отказоустойчивости существенно ниже. Отдельно стоит отметить низкий уровень информационной безопасности файл-серверной архитектуры, т.к. файл базы данных может быть скопирован любым пользователем 1С.

· Сервер баз данных выполняет обработку и сохранность данных, обеспечивая при этом быстродействие, параллельность и отказоустойчивость. Он, так же как и Сервер 1С является важной обязательной частью «клиент-серверной» архитектуры. Сервер 1С совместим с наиболее распространенными коммерческими продуктами: MS SQL , Oracle Database , IBM DB 2 и свободно-распространяемой Postgre SQL . Но по кулуарному признанию сотрудников 1С наилучшую совместимость с Сервером 1С имеет MS SQL .

· Веб-сервер нужен для работы веб-клиента через Интернет . Веб-сервер поддерживает как клиент-серверную так и файл-серверную архитектуры. IIS входит в состав Windows системы. Apache – свободно-распространяемый продукт.

· Мобильная платформа подразумевает готовое приложение для мобильных устройств на iOS , Android или Windows Phone , которое может работать автономно с собственной базой данных в отсутствие связи с центральной базой (без Интернета, в режиме off - line ). Такая база может обмениваться данными с полноценной стационарной базой по интернету с использованием механизом "планы обмена" и "веб-сервисы".

· COM -соединение – это особый вид подключения «напрямую» между двумя приложениями, расположенными на одном компьютере, для обмена данными . Такой вид подключения ускоряет процесс синхронизации, например, между «1С :Б ухгалтерия предприятия» и «1С:Управление торговлей», т.к. при этом не используется промежуточный файл обмена. Механизм доступен только в среде Windows .

· 1С :П редприятие в режиме «Конфигуратор» - это инструмент для администрирования, конфигурирования и разработки. Механизм доступен только в Windows и Linux . В перспективе 1С готовит к выпуску новую интегрированную среду разработки на базе технологии Eclipse , которая так же является кроссплатформенной.

В Таблице 2 для каждой компоненты технологической платформы 1С :П редприятие указан необходимый вид лицензии. Для полноценной работы платформы 1С в режиме «файл-сервер» достаточно клиентской лицензии. Для работы в режиме «клиент-сервер» кроме клиентской лицензии понадобится еще лицензия на сервер, а так же лицензия на сервер базы данных (СУБД). В качестве СУБД компания 1С использует продукты сторонних производителей ( вендоров ), поэтому за подробностями по ценовой политике надо обращаться к ним. Но отдельно стоит отметить Runtime лицензии: компания 1С совместно с Microsoft , IBM и Oracle предлагает партнерскую продукцию со значительной скидкой – ограниченные по запуску лицензии, не позволяющие совместное использование СУБД ни с какими другими прикладными решениями, кроме сервера 1С. При этом само взаимодействие с сервером 1С является полноценным, без каких либо ограничений.

Несколько слов о видах лицензий на наиболее популярную СУБД - MS SQL . Всего их два:

· «На рабочие места», в этом случае приобретается два вида лицензий: на сервер MS SQL и клиентские доступы по числу максимально возможных клиентских подключений

· «На ядро», в этом случае приобретается только лицензия на сервер MS SQL , разрешающая неограниченное количество клиентских подключений.

Отдельно стоит отметить работу платформы 1С в качестве приложения для мобильных устройств: до 15.07.2015 никаких дополнительных лицензий не требовалось, достаточно было лицензий, установленных на сервере центральной базы данных, с которой такое приложение может взаимодействовать через web -сервисы. Не считая сервисной платы, взимаемой Google, Apple и Microsoft за возможность выкладывать свои приложения на Google Play, AppStore и Windows Phone Store. Теперь же действуют новые правила:

- по прежнему не требуется лицензия на тиражные мобильные приложения, предназначенные для распространения среди третьих лиц, в т. ч. через магазины приложений AppStore и Google Play (как за плату, так и бесплатно)

- если приложение разработано для собственных нужд компании, то в этом случае необходимо приобрести "клиентскую лицензию на мобильное рабочее место". Причем на одном мобильном устройстве может быть установлено несколько разных 1С-приложений, столько же лицензий необходимо приобрести. Клиентская лицензия на мобильные рабочие места представляет собой документ с указанным количеством рабочих мест.

В Таблице 3 указаны различные варианты размещения программных клиентских лицензий, или простыми словами - кто занимается раздачей лицензий. Дается сравнительный анализ всех вариантов. Расшифруем основные понятия:

· Расход лицензий «на рабочий стол» означает, что пользователь на одном компьютере или в одной терминальной сессии может открыть любое количество сеансов (окон) 1С, и при этом израсходуется только одна клиентская лицензия.

· Расход лицензий «на соединение» означает, что один сеанс (окно) 1С отнимает одну клиентскую лицензию.

· Конкурентное лицензирование означает, что потенциальных пользователей может быть существенно больше, чем одновременных подключений 1С. Это связано с тем, что некоторая часть пользователей находится в офисе не целый рабочий день (выездная работа, командировки, отпуска, больничные), некоторые пользователи разнесены по разным часовым поясам и никогда не пересекаются , руководители открывают 1С периодически, чтобы посмотреть отчеты. В таких случаях вероятность, что все пользователи одновременно войдут в 1С чрезвычайно мала . Значит, нет смысла платить за лицензии для всех пользователей, имеет смысл ориентироваться на наиболее вероятное максимальное количество одновременных подключений. Такой эффект тем ярче выражен, чем крупнее компания.

В Таблице 4 указана ценовая политика для всех типов 1С-лицензий технологической платформы. Расшифруем основные понятия:

Аппаратная лицензия (ключ защиты) конструктивно выполнена в форме USB - флешки . Раздачей клиентских и серверных лицензий в локальной сети занимается программное обеспечение License Manager от стороннего производителя Sentinel (бывший Aladdin) .

Программная лицензия – это комплект пинкодов , с помощью которых происходит активизация лицензий и их привязка к определенному компьютеру. Раздачей программных клиентских и серверных лицензий занимается сервер 1С. Раздавать программные клиентские лицензии так же может Web -сервер.

Документ, регулирующий правила использования мобильной платформы "1С:Предприятие" на количестве мобильных рабочих мест, указанных в лицензии.

Версия КОРП технологической платформы в отличие от обычной версии ПРОФ:

· расширяет возможности администрирования сервера 1С,

· действует более самостоятельно при решении сбойных ситуаций

· выполняет более умную балансировку нагрузки на аппаратное обеспечение.

Все эти меры в первую очередь направлены на повышение отказоустойчивости кластера серверов 1С при работе с высоконагруженными базами данных.

В Таблице 5 приведен сравнительный анализ программной и аппаратной лицензий.

Таблица 1 . Компоненты технологической платформы 1С :П редприятие 8.3 и совместимые с ними операционные системы

Инструкция по переходу с файловой базы на SQL


Итак, если выбор сделан в пользу клиент-серверного режима, то для того, чтобы перенести базу 1С 8.3 (8.2) с файловой системы, необходимо проделать следующие шаги:

1. Создать новую БД 1С в SQL.

2. Выгрузить файл *.dt из файловой базы (Конфигуратор — Администрирование — Выгрузка информационной базы).

3. Загрузить этот файл в новую базу (Конфигуратор — Администрирование — Загрузка информационной базы).


Подведем итоги


Безусловно, выбор варианта наиболее подходящего режима - это вопрос исключительно индивидуальный. По опыту работы дадим несколько рекомендаций.

1. Для небольшой организации с умеренным документооборотом разумно на первое время остановится на файловом варианте.

2. Если объем информации значительный, то лучше сразу выбрать клиент-серверный вариант.

Важно понимать, что если организация растет и расширяется, то можно легко и просто, когда понадобится, сделать переход от файлового к клиент-серверному режиму.


Единый семинар 1С для бухгалтеров и руководителей


Обучающие видеокурсы по 1С


Интервью со студенткой ОГУ уголовно-правового профиля

Отзывы о компании

ПАО "НИКО-БАНК" выражает свою благодарность за оперативную и грамотную работу.
В условиях постоянно меняющегося законодательства Банк заинтересован иметь полную и актуальную номативную базу. Это обеспечивается использованием Банком справочно-нормативной системы "Гарант".
Безусловным плюсом в работе компании "МастерСофт" является быстрое реагирование сотрудников при предоставлении документов по запросу Банка, принятых до обновления справочно-правовой системы.

Коллектив компании "АЭРОПОРТ ОРЕНБУРГ" выражает благодарность за взаимовыгодное сотрудничество с МастерСофт-ИТ. Оперативная поставка антивирусных программ Dr. Web обеспечила надежную защиту нашей компьтерной сети.
Особая благодарность сотрудникам Департамента продаж СЦ ИТ за профессиональный подход в решении всех возникающих задач.

ООО "Орский Вагонный Завод" выражает искреннюю благодраность за качество обслуживания вашими специалистами. Консультации и поставка антивирусов всегда проходят оперативно и на высоком профессиональном уровне.
Уверены, что и в дальнейшем наше сотрудничество на взаимовыгодных условиях продолжится.

Главный бухгалтер муниципального бюджетного учреждения дополнительного образования "Дворец творчества детей и молодёжи" Кетерер Татьяна Михайловна выражает благодарность специалистам МастерСофт:
"Я хотела бы объявить благодарность вашим сотрудникам. Работает с нами по программе "1С: Бухгалтерия бюджетного учреждения 8" непосредственно Шевлягина Юлия.
Так же огромная благодарность за отзывчивость, терпение и квалифицированную, своевременную помощь Набокиной Олесе и Ерёменко Татьяне (они нас сопровождают по программе "Зарплата и Кадры").
Им очень с нами тяжело, но они терпеливо продолжают сотрудничать. С вами очень надёжно. Конечно же наши ошибки есть и без вас мы бы вообще о них не знали и в суде, наверное, судились бы. А сейчас мы решаем вопросы. ".

1.jpg

ПАО "НИКО-БАНК" выражает свою благодарность за оперативную и грамотную работу.
В условиях постоянно меняющегося законодательства Банк заинтересован иметь полную и актуальную номативную базу. Это обеспечивается использованием Банком справочно-нормативной системы "Гарант".
Безусловным плюсом в работе компании "МастерСофт" является быстрое реагирование сотрудников при предоставлении документов по запросу Банка, принятых до обновления справочно-правовой системы.

Коллектив компании "АЭРОПОРТ ОРЕНБУРГ" выражает благодарность за взаимовыгодное сотрудничество с МастерСофт-ИТ. Оперативная поставка антивирусных программ Dr. Web обеспечила надежную защиту нашей компьтерной сети.
Особая благодарность сотрудникам Департамента продаж СЦ ИТ за профессиональный подход в решении всех возникающих задач.

ООО "Орский Вагонный Завод" выражает искреннюю благодраность за качество обслуживания вашими специалистами. Консультации и поставка антивирусов всегда проходят оперативно и на высоком профессиональном уровне.
Уверены, что и в дальнейшем наше сотрудничество на взаимовыгодных условиях продолжится.

Главный бухгалтер муниципального бюджетного учреждения дополнительного образования "Дворец творчества детей и молодёжи" Кетерер Татьяна Михайловна выражает благодарность специалистам МастерСофт:
"Я хотела бы объявить благодарность вашим сотрудникам. Работает с нами по программе "1С: Бухгалтерия бюджетного учреждения 8" непосредственно Шевлягина Юлия.
Так же огромная благодарность за отзывчивость, терпение и квалифицированную, своевременную помощь Набокиной Олесе и Ерёменко Татьяне (они нас сопровождают по программе "Зарплата и Кадры").
Им очень с нами тяжело, но они терпеливо продолжают сотрудничать. С вами очень надёжно. Конечно же наши ошибки есть и без вас мы бы вообще о них не знали и в суде, наверное, судились бы. А сейчас мы решаем вопросы. ".

Анна Викулина

При начале работ по установке и настройке 1С в любой компании встает вопрос выбора СУБД для обслуживания базы данных. Сотруднику, который ранее не сталкивался с этим вопросом, сложно разобраться в терминах и определиться с окончательным выбором. А ведь правильно подобранная и настроенная СУБД серьезно облегчит дальнейшую жизнь, поскольку от этого зависит, насколько оперативно будут обрабатываться команды 1С. Перед тем как определиться с СУБД, стоит узнать о специфике самых популярных из них.

Варианты работы 1С

Для начала стоит рассказать о специальном режиме работы 1С, в котором вообще не нужна внешняя СУБД. Речь идет о файловом режиме, в котором роль СУБД и сервера выполняет встроенный в 1С механизм. Это бюджетный вариант ведения учета, так как нет необходимости приобретать сервер и лицензии на него. Но данный вариант используется достаточно редко из-за небольшой скорости работы, низкой надежности и собственных ограничений 1С:

  • Все таблицы представлены в виде 4 отдельных файлов, размер каждого из которых не может превышать 4 Гб:
    1. Описание таблицы;
    2. Индексы;
    3. Значения неограниченной длины;
    4. Записи.
  • Ограничения длины ключа в индексах и количества полей для индексации;
  • Возможные проблемы с выполнением регламентных заданий в ранних версиях 1С;
  • Отсутствие возможности одновременного проведения документов;
  • Прямой доступ пользователей к базе данных – любой сотрудник может случайно удалить ее или сделать копию.

Все вышеперечисленные моменты подводят к тому, что если количество пользователей больше 1, то необходимо использовать клиент-серверный вариант базы 1С. Он предпочтительнее со всех точек зрения, кроме стоимости – она действительно выше. Ведь в этом случае необходимо приобрести сервер приложений 1С и установить СУБД.

На сегодняшний день системы 1С официально поддерживают следующие виды:

  • Платная MS SQL. Также существует бесплатная модификация MS SQL express edition, но у нее действует ограничение на размер базы данных – до 10 гб. Для удовлетворительного ведения учета компании этого явно недостаточно, поэтому этот вариант больше подходит для разработчиков;
  • Платная Oracle BD;
  • Бесплатная IBM DB2;
  • Бесплатная PostgreSQL.


Особенности различных СУБД

При выборе не стоит опираться только на цену, так как СУБД сами по себе имеют множество особенностей. Их необходимо учесть заранее, поскольку, если этого не сделать, возможны существенные проблемы при работе пользователей. Самая популярная СУБД – MS SQL, поэтому знать ее отличительные особенности должны все профессионалы, работающие с ней:

  1. Небольшой размер БД постепенно растет по мере поступления новых данных;
  2. По умолчанию 1 файл с данными и 1 с логами;
  3. Требовательна к ресурсам;
  4. Нетребовательна к квалификации администратора, хорошо интегрируется с продуктами от Microsoft;
  5. Максимальное количество таблиц, используемых в запросе, ограничено 256.

Следующая из платных СУБД – Oracle BD:

  1. Высокие требования к квалификации администраторов;
  2. В подзапросах нельзя использовать конструкции «ПЕРВЫЕ» и «УПОРЯДОЧИТЬ»;
  3. При сортировке NULL ставится в конец таблицы;
  4. Статистические данные планов запроса ресурсозатратны.

Бесплатная PostgreSQL, популярность которой все интенсивнее растет в последнее время, и уже появляются мнения, что она способна потеснить MS SQL. Пока об этом говорить преждевременно, но знать особенности этой СУБД в современных условиях весьма полезно:

  1. Требования к квалификации существуют, весьма желательно понимать основные принципы и структуру БД;
  2. Достаточно требовательна данная СУБД и к ресурсам, но не как MS SQL;
  3. При сортировке NULL по умолчанию находится в начале таблицы. Но с помощью оператора NULLS LAST можно убрать эти значения в конец таблицы;
  4. Необходимость частой реиндексации при интенсивной работе;
  5. Требовательность к скорости записи и чтения жестких дисков;
  6. Полное внешнее соединение работает намного медленнее, чем в других СУБД;
  7. Облачные базы 1С:Фреш работают как раз на этой СУБД.

Об IBM DB2 можно сказать следующее:

  1. Средняя требовательность к квалификации специалистов;
  2. При создании базы резервируется место «на будущее» – базы «весят» существенно больше;
  3. Слабые возможности механизма временных таблиц, благодаря чему требования к ресурсам пониженные. Также скорость работы снижается и при использовании подзапросов;
  4. В операции like или подобно запрещено использовать шаблоны;
  5. В выборке не может быть более 1012 колонок;
  6. При группировке и сравнении различает регистр;
  7. Нетипизированное значение NULL;
  8. Ограничения длины ресурсов регистров и чисел.

К выбору СУБД нужно подходить весьма ответственно, не теряя из виду все важные факторы. При возможности стоит посоветоваться с профессионалами, уже имевшими опыт работы с базами на вышеперечисленных системах. Также стоит опираться на количество пользователей в вашей компании и сложность системы 1С. Практика администраторов 1С показывает, что производительность бесплатных СУБД ниже, чем MS SQL или Oracle.

Читайте также: